Job description

Overview

Job Title: Applications Engineer

Location: Cambridge, ON | On-site

Job Type: Full-time

Compensation: $110,000 - $140,000 per year

Benefits: RRSP, health/dental/vision package, reimbursement for tuition and professional dues, paid vacation, personal days, and sick days

The Position

The Applications Engineer is a key member of the sales team, responsible for developing proposals and supporting the Sales Account Managers. Key directives include maintaining and servicing specific customer accounts and responding to requests for quotations in a timely and efficient manner, while delivering the Eclipse Vision and the Eclipse Entrepreneurial Culture.

What You’ll Be Doing

  • Participate in customer RFQ review meetings, either on-site at the customer or in-house
  • Prepare cell layout drawings for the various RFQ's
  • Liaise between mechanical engineering, electrical engineering and assembly manufacturing groups for technical assistance in developing concepts and processes and provide assistance in estimating labor and material costs to meet customer requirements
  • Liaise with suppliers to obtain estimates of major material and equipment costs required for the preparation of budgets and proposals
  • Prepare equipment layouts
  • Participate in the elaboration of the list and schedule of technical deliverables for the complete project as well as the corresponding list of interfaces
  • Write technical specifications
  • Technical follow-up during engineering, procurement & construction
  • Identify technical risks and their impact on the project & mitigate their effects
  • Prepares specifications and estimates costs
  • Provide proactive customer design support for vertically integrated components and complex electro-mechanical assemblies
  • Work with internal and external design and technology functions to create unique specifications and applications
  • Work to specific project budgets and timelines provided by Applications Manager
  • Prepare draft budget and quotation proposals for review with the Applications Supervisor, the Sales Manager and Key Account Managers
  • Attend escalation and red flags as directed by Applications Manager
  • Recognize problems, initiate action, assist in problem solving and evaluate results
  • Assist with conflict resolution at early stages
  • Promote positive relations with internal customers, partners, customers, vendors, and distributors
  • Liaise between all departments as required to ensure on time delivery proposals, and internal procedures are executed in a timely manner
  • Notify the Applications Manager as early as possible if milestones cannot be met
  • Attend appropriate meetings when required (Opportunity Review & Short Term Bookings)
  • Ensure that Company ISO Standards are followed
  • Represent the company at various community and/or business meetings to promote the company
  • Complete other duties and projects as assigned
  • Expectation of travel up to 30% of time could be anticipated, however may be exceeded in exceptional circumstances to meet project needs

What We’re Looking For

  • 10+ years of experience within an automation experience (OEM)
  • 5+ years of experience in an applications engineering capacity
  • Experience with projects within the life sciences industry is an asset
  • University Degree or College Diploma in Mechanical/Electrical Engineering or Mechatronics
  • Must have excellent experience with AutoCAD and Solid Works and be familiar with MS Office
  • Experience with hydraulics, pneumatics and electrical controls and integration of equipment
  • Experience and working knowledge of most CSA, ANSI and CE standards
  • Work requires professional written and verbal communication and interpersonal skills
  • Ability to motivate teams to produce quality proposals within tight timeframes, with changing priorities
  • Conflict resolution skills are and asset
  • Must be self-motivated and lead by example with a positive attitude and outlook in the company
